BLOODSTOCK ANNOUNCE CHARITY - LEMMY SIGNED BASS TO BE AUCTIONED FOR TEENAGE CANCER TRUST
By Terrorizer Newshound on Aug 10, 2011 | In News, Announcements, News
Bloodstock have announced that this year’s official charity is Teenage Cancer Trust.
There will be a charity donation of £10 at the box office for those festival-goers who are on the guestlist – though not compulsory every penny helps! Also to raise money for the charity, Lemmy from Motorhead (who will headline the festival on the Sunday) will be signing a Vintage White Yamaha BB424X bass that Teenage Cancer Trust will auction off via their eBay page.
